Child Support Obligations:

Child Support: Financial contributions from a non-custodial parent to support their child(ren).

  • Purpose: To ensure the child's basic needs, such as housing, food, clothing, healthcare, and education, are met.
  • Determination: Child support payments are typically determined by state law and consider factors like income, the child's age, and specific needs.

Consequences of Non-Compliance:

  • Legal Action: Courts can impose various sanctions, including fines, jail time, and the suspension of driving privileges.
  • Credit Damage: Non-payment can damage credit scores, making it difficult to secure loans or rent apartments.
  • Parental Alienation: Non-compliance can create animosity and tension between the parent and child, potentially affecting the parent-child relationship.
